April 12, 2025

The UK Parliament urgently passed the Steel Industry (Special Measures) Bill to save British Steel's Scunthorpe plant and 3,500 jobs, granting the Business Secretary significant control over the company's assets. The rushed process and lack of debate on amendments, including a proposed sunset clause, led to frustration among MPs, though the bill ultimately received Royal Assent and became law.
